COMPILING THE PROJECT MANUAL AND PROJECT STANDARDS

One of the most important items on the to-do-list for our project management work is the development of the so called project manual. In this compilation of documents, we collect all essential aspects like the project goals and the Work Breakdown Structure WBS that depicts the scheduled project workflow as a set of plannable and controllable elements. We also list the core team members with their assigned tasks and responsibilities, as well as all time schedules – and budget plans. In addition, all relevant technical project specifications, standards and guidelines are laid down in this set of documents.

Throughout the course of all project phases, the project manual stipulates the terms of reference for all parties involved. In order to comply with that, it shall be updated regularly to consistently reflect the actual situation and to document the development of the entire project.

MANAGEMENT OF CHANGE

Each project process carries changes within, both planned and unplanned. The implementation of a properly structured change management procedure prevents you from experiencing unpleasant surprises, which usually pop up towards project completion, when contractors present invoices for some alleged but badly documented change orders from your side. STAKEHOLDER MANAGEMENT

This term represents a particularly important topic in the area of the project marketing.
Based on R. E. Freeman’s approach, not only the shareholders do have a legitimate interest in, or are affected by a process/project, but, depending on the circumstances, an even much wider range of persons and organizations do. In the time sensitive course of a project, the timely integration of these groups in an active stakeholder management process pays for itself within a short period of time.

COST, TIME & RESOURCE PLANNING; THE CTR MASTER PLAN

In demand of a reliable base for any professional project controlling and reporting purposes, we prepare an integrated CTR master plan during the project development phase, which shall reflect all the essential parameters and their correlation. This document, which is usually set up as a comprehensive Gantt-Chart is of vital importance during project implementation and shall therefore be updated regularly in accordance with the latest developments and the actual status of the project.
